Specifically, students from the Lombardy region who distinguished themselves from others for their academic results will receive cash prizes. These are therefore scholarships to be allocated to the most deserving students who have achieved the highest evaluations. The amount of the scholarship is equal to 500 euros for students of the third and fourth grades who report an average of marks equal to or greater than 9. The value of the grant instead rises to 1,500 euros for students with a grade equal to 100 and honors State exams The same amount is due to students who obtain the professional diploma with the final grade of 100.

The sums of money due are to be used for the purchase of teaching material or to cover the costs of enrolling in university courses. On the portal official of the Lombardy region, the reader will be able to view requirements, conditions and date of submission of applications. Applications for grants must be submitted online on the platform and the opening dates of the call will be announced shortly.
